Understanding Varicose Veins
Causes and Risk Factors
Varicose veins develop when vein walls weaken and valves fail, causing blood to pool. Risk factors include genetics, aging, prolonged sitting or standing, obesity, and sedentary lifestyle. Modern Minimally Invasive Techniques
Endovenous Laser Ablation (EVLA)
EVLA involves inserting a laser fiber into the affected vein to collapse it and redirect blood flow to healthier veins. It offers fast recovery, minimal discomfort, and excellent cosmetic results, making it a preferred method for laser vein closure.
Radiofrequency Ablation (RFA)
RFA uses controlled heat to close medium and large veins efficiently. Patients experience minimal post-procedure pain and can resume daily activities quickly, highlighting its role in minimally invasive vein treatment.
Foam Sclerotherapy
Foam sclerotherapy targets small or superficial veins using specialized foam that collapses them. It is highly effective for cosmetic vein correction and can be combined with other procedures for optimal outcomes.

Matching Treatment to Vein Type
| Vein Type | Recommended Treatment | Recovery Time |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Large veins with reflux | EVLA or RFA | 1–2 days | Rapid symptom relief |
| Medium veins | RFA or foam sclerotherapy | 1 day | Minimally invasive, quick recovery |
| Small/cosmetic veins | Foam sclerotherapy or CLaCS | Same day | Multiple sessions may be required |
| Reticular veins | Foam sclerotherapy | 1 day | Primarily cosmetic improvement |

Pre-Treatment Considerations
Vein Assessment
Doppler ultrasound or vein mapping evaluates vein size, location, and reflux severity. Accurate assessment ensures optimal Varicose Treatment selection.

Post-Treatment Care
Activity and Movement
Walking immediately after Varicose Treatment promotes circulation and supports vein closure.
Compression Therapy
Wearing compression stockings for 1–2 weeks, followed by daytime use for several weeks, enhances results and minimizes recurrence risk.
Avoid Prolonged Sitting or Standing
Frequent movement reduces vein pressure and supports healing.
Follow-Up Monitoring
Ultrasound check-ups confirm vein closure and prevent new reflux, ensuring long-term success.
Expected Outcomes
Symptom Relief
Leg heaviness, swelling, and discomfort typically improve within days to weeks.
Cosmetic Results
Visible improvement occurs within 1–4 weeks, with full results in 6–12 weeks.
Longevity
Results are long-lasting with proper post-care and lifestyle management. Recurrence risk is minimized with adherence.
